2 Tropical storm forming east of Taiwan, will not directly affect but brings raishowers



There were two tropical storm forming east of Taiwan but will not likely to directly hit Taiwan, according to data of Central Weather Bureau of Taiwan.


The first tropical depression was located 1,600 kilometers southeast of Taiwan's southernmost point and was moving in a westerly direction at 15 kilometers per hour toward the Philippines.

The second tropical depression located 4,400 km from Taiwan between Guam and Wake Island is also likely to develop into a storm within the next two days, but it will also not come close to Taiwan.

Reported by Central News Agency, the two tropical storms will split as one going to Philippines and the other going to Japan.
